  • Question 3
    1 / -0
    If the sum of the circumferences of two circles with radii $$R_1$$ and $$ R_2$$ is equal to the circumference of a circle of radius $$R$$, then
    Solution
    The  circumference of circle with radius $${ R }_{ 1 }=2\pi { R }_{ 1 }$$.
    and the circumference of circle with radius$$ { R }_{ 2 }=2\pi { R }_{ 2 }.$$ 
    $$\therefore$$ The Sum of Circumferences, $$Sum=2\pi \left( { R }_{ 1 }+{ R }_{ 2 } \right)$$ .
    Again the circumference of circle with radius $${ R }=2\pi { R }.$$
    $$ \therefore$$ By given condition,
    $$ 2\pi \left( { R }_{ 1 }+{ R }_{ 2 } \right) =2\pi { R }\Longrightarrow { R }_{ 1 }+{ R }_{ 2 }=R$$.

    State true or false:
    A circle of radius $$3$$cm can be drawn through two points $$A, B$$ such that $$AB = 6$$ cm. 
    Solution
    We know, diameter of a circle $$=2\times$$ radius of the circle.
    A circle with $$AB=6cm$$ as diameter will have its radius equal to $$3cm$$.
    So option $$B$$ is the right answer.
